AB2534 Compliance - Effective January 1, 2025
Effective January 1, 2025, and in accordance with California Education Code Section 44939.5, all applicants for certificated positions must disclose a complete list of all Local Education Agencies (LEAs) where they have been previously employed, including full-time, part-time, or substitute roles. LEAs include school districts, county offices of education, charter schools, and state special schools. Failure to provide this information may be considered an act of dishonesty and could affect hiring decisions.
This list will be requested upon a job offer extension.
